ETH — Latest Market
August 2026
$ETH is currently trading around $1,870–$1,900, with the market under short-term selling pressure. ETH has fallen below the psychologically important $1,900 area as the broader crypto market weakened.
📊 Technical picture
Trend: Short-term bearish/weak
Momentum: Sellers currently have the advantage.
Price structure: ETH is attempting to stabilize around the $1.9K region after its recent recovery.
Resistance: The $2,000 area remains an important psychological barrier.
Support: The recent ~$1,870–$1,900 region is being closely watched for stabilization.
Volume/liquidations: Recent volatility has been amplified by leveraged positioning.
🏦 Fundamental & macro factors
US inflation data is a major near-term market catalyst, with traders becoming more cautious ahead of the release.
ETH ETF demand: Institutional demand has eased somewhat recently; one report cited $14.59M of net outflows from U.S. spot ETH ETFs.
Staking: Ethereum staking has reached a record level, showing continued participation in the network despite the weaker price action.
Network fundamentals: Ethereum's scaling ecosystem continues expanding through Layer-2 networks, while research indicates major reductions in transaction costs following scaling upgrades.
🧭 Overall assessment
Short-term: Bearish/Neutral ⚠️
Medium-term: Mixed
Fundamentals: Strong, but price momentum currently weak
The key story right now is macro pressure + declining short-term momentum vs. strong Ethereum network fundamentals. A sustained recovery would need improving market sentiment and stronger demand; continued weakness could keep ETH under pressure.
